Pipe Clearing in Denver, CO
Pipe clearing services involve removing blockages and buildup from residential plumbing systems to ensure smooth water flow throughout a property. These services typically address issues such as clogged drains, slow-running sinks, backed-up toilets, and obstructed main sewer lines. Projects can range from clearing minor kitchen or bathroom drain clogs to more extensive work on main sewer lines that affect the entire property’s plumbing system. Property owners often seek pipe clearing when experiencing persistent drainage problems or foul odors, aiming to restore proper function and prevent potential water damage or backups.
Before requesting pipe clearing, homeowners should consider the location and nature of the issue, such as whether it affects a single fixture or multiple drains, and whether there are any signs of recurring problems. It’s also helpful to understand the type of plumbing system in place, including pipe materials and layout, as well as any recent changes or repairs that might influence the scope of work. Proper diagnosis can ensure that the appropriate tools and techniques are used to effectively resolve blockages and maintain the longevity of the plumbing system.

Common Pipe Clearing Jobs
Kitchen drain clearing - removes blockages from sinks and garbage disposals to restore proper flow.
Main sewer line cleaning - addresses severe clogs that affect the entire property’s drainage system.
Outdoor drain clearing - clears leaves, dirt, and debris from yard drains and stormwater systems.
Bathroom drain service - resolves slow or backed-up toilets, tubs, and shower drains.
Pipe snaking - uses specialized tools to break up stubborn clogs deep within pipes.
Video pipe inspection - identifies blockages, damage, or tree root intrusion inside underground pipes.
Pipe Clearing Questions
What causes pipe blockages? Common causes include grease buildup, hair, debris, and tree roots infiltrating underground pipes.
How can I tell if my pipes are clogged? Sign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ling sounds, and foul odors coming from drains.
Are chemical drain cleaners effective? Chemical cleaners may temporarily clear minor blockages but can damage pipes over time and are not always effective for severe clogs.
What types of pipes can be cleared? Services typically address kitchen and bathroom drains, main sewer lines, and outdoor pipes affected by blockages or obstructions.
